Default Sc400 ls430 diff swap

Hi I'm swapping a ls430 diff into my 94 sc400 and have it mounted up and i went to put the half shafts in and it looks like the teeth on the flange are a little wider than the ls430 diff. I was lightly tapping the flange in it went in about an inch or so then got hard like it bottomed out so i tapped it back out and the first inch of the shaft is burd on both sides of the teeth spline count is the same just wondering if anyone has had this problem or can give a solution
